A Remote Medical Device Engineer designs, develops, and tests medical devices while working from a remote location. They ensure compliance with industry regulations and collaborate with cross-functional teams to improve device functionality and safety. Responsibilities may include CAD modeling, prototyping, software integration, and regulatory documentation. Remote engineers use digital tools to communicate with teams and manage development processes efficiently. Strong technical expertise and knowledge of medical device regulations are essential for this role.
A typical workday as a Remote Medical Device Engineer often involves designing and reviewing device components using CAD software, participating in virtual meetings to coordinate with R&D, quality assurance, and regulatory teams, and conducting documentation for regulatory submissions. You may also troubleshoot technical issues, analyze test data, and provide design updates based on feedback or test results. Regular communication with colleagues across different time zones is common, requiring flexibility and excellent organizational skills. The remote nature of the role typically offers autonomy and flexibility while maintaining close collaboration with diverse, cross-functional teams to ensure projects progress smoothly.
To thrive as a Remote Medical Device Engineer, you need a solid background in biomedical engineering or related fields, along with experience in product development, regulatory compliance, and device testing. Familiarity with CAD software, FDA regulations (such as 21 CFR Part 820), and risk management systems is typically required, and certifications like PMP or Six Sigma can be advantageous. Strong problem-solving abilities, effective remote communication skills, and the ability to collaborate across distributed teams are crucial soft skills. These qualifications ensure that engineers can design safe, compliant devices and contribute effectively to remote, cross-functional teams.

Our engineering team solves one of the most important problems of the modern economy - connecting great people with great jobs. We believe this problem can only be solved with technology, and we developed a software platform that has supported over 100M job seekers to date (with 5M joining every month). We are looking for a backend engineer to help us build the next chapter of that vision. You may be located anywhere in Germany or Poland and work remotely or out of one of our hub offices.
We designed our R&D structure based on the empowered product teams model. It means our teams are responsible for business outcomes and have autonomy in solving problems in the way that “customers love yet works for the business” (yes, we are heavily influenced by this and this).
Our technology platform is a SaaS product hosted on AWS (and soon also GCP). Our system is composed of hundreds of independent services (each sitting on Docker, orchestrated by Kubernetes).
We build most of our services in Java, Javascript (Node.js), and Python. We have a strong CI/CD culture, and we currently run 40 production deployments per engineer per month.
